Cubix: Robots For Everyone (2001) was a short-lived Korean All-CGI Cartoon, set in the future not so far away where robots capable of emotions and independent thought are commonplace.The plot revolves around a boy named Connor and his Robot Buddy Cubix, a Super Prototype made of modular blocks who can transform into a number of useful forms. Along with his friends from the local robot repair shop (the "Botties"), Connor and Cubix battle the evil Dr. K as he tries to collect a mysterious substance called Solex that's causing robots to go berserk.The series was commissioned, licensed and dubbed by 4Kids Entertainment and was animated by Korean animation studios Cinepix and Dai Won.4Kids worked together with Cinepix to produce the show. As such the Korean version came first and the English version was based upon it, with several scenes featuring new animation being created solely for the English version. For example, more scenes were added into the first episode showing the Botties warming up to Connor as he works on Cubix.Other international dubs are based on the English dub with the exception of the Japanese dub (commissioned and produced by Xebec) which borrows elements from both the English and Korean version for its own unique adaptation. |

All There in the Manual: Some pieces of information are never mentioned within the series and were instead present on external media. For example many of the background robots' names were only revealed on promotional media. The book "Connor's guide to Bubble Town" claims the Disposix the Botties rescued was named "Pepe" though said detail is never mentioned within episode 4. This is actually a case of Lost in Translation as in the original Korean dub, Disposix was indeed named Pepe. Scenes showing Professor Nemo discovering Solex and the explosion at Robixcorp were only shown on promotional tapes. |

Recycled Soundtrack: Some of the BGM in the Korean version was stock music that had been featured in other shows such as Aqua Teen Hunger Force, Megas XLR and Spongebob Squarepants. For example: The track that plays when Dr K. first attacks the Botties Pit was also used in an episode of Aqua Teen Hunger Force. The track that plays as the Botties escape the sewer is the title card music for "The Sponge Who Could Fly" The track that plays when Dr K. activates his giant robot is The Glorft theme in Megas XLR. |

Disney Death: Happens a total of four times during the series. Cubix twice near the end of Season 1 and once in Season 2, first in Season 1 when he gets blown up by Antix robots delivered to the Botties' Pit by Raska and is later revived by Connor's friendship with him, and the second time when he pulls off a Heroic Sacrifice to stop the Kulminator and is revived by the Solex that powered it. In Season 2, he is temporarily destroyed by Kilobot before once again being revived by The Power of Friendship. And Maximix at the end of season 2, who is killed by Kilobot, and is brought back using the data that Kilobot had absorbed from Maximix in an earlier episode. Subverted somewhat as Maximix lost some of his memory as a result. |

She's a Man in Japan: Inversed. Some robots that were clearly modeled with feminine voices in the original Korean dub are given masculine voices in the English dub and are referred to with male pronouns. Some examples would include Don Don, Cerebrix and Diagnostix. Raska's alien form was explicitly female in the original Korean version too though the English dub gives her alien form distinctly a male voice. |

Insert Song: There were a few insert songs used in some episodes, composed by the Harmonix. Though some were only present on the DVD release. Episode 1 had "Suddenly", which plays over a montage of the Botties warming up to Connor as he works on Cubix. Episode 2 had "You can never have", which plays during Connor and Cubix's little race. Some airings such as the Hulu version cut this scene out entirely and then had new narration by Connor later on in the episode during the song's reprise. Episode 14 had "You may be...", which plays during Chip's sadness montage about being short. Some airings such as the Hulu version removed this song entirely, instead having narration by Chip during the montage instead. Another interesting note is the fact that this song was also featured in the Korean dub with Korean lyrics, making this song the only example of background music used in both dubs. |

Heart Drive: What the Emotional Processing Unit (EPU for short) invented by Professor Nemo essentially is: a computer core that gives a robot thoughts and feelings equivalent to those of a human. In the show's setting, all modern robots have one. |

Dub Name Change: In the Japanese dub, Connor is named "Ichiro", Cubix is "Combock", Mong is "Ryuuta", Maximix is "Blue-motor", Chip is "Takumi", Cerebrix is "Mini-Com", "Bubble Town" is "New Musashino City", Kan-It is "Mag-Pyon", Professor Nemo is "Doctor Hanami", Solex is "Crystanium", Doctor K is "Professor K" and Kilobot is "Black Vader K". Averted with Kolossal and Abby who retain their Korean names and "Endurix" whose name is the same in all dubs. |

Never Say "Die": Unusually (for a 4Kids dub) averted in the first season, though played straight in the second. First example would be in Episode 1 where Connor jokes his dad would kill him for running away. Then in Episode 2 Connor outright states his mother had died years ago. Then in Episode 5 where Hela claims her father died in an accident. And in Episode 7 Hela at one point states "Are you trying to get us killed!?" In episode 24, this trope is played straight as the characters all but name drop an explosive device attached to Maximix. |
